Q. 57 A function is continuous in the interval [0, 2]. It is known that f(0) = f(2) = -1 and f(1) = 1. Which one of the following statements must be true.

(A) There exist a y in the interval (0, 1), such that f(y) = f(y+1)

(B) For every y in the interval (0, 1) , f(y) = f(2-y)

(C) The maximum value of the function in the interval (0, 2) is 1

(D) There exist a y in the interval (0, 1), such that f(y) = -f(2-y)

Answer: (A)
